Charles Dickens, born in 1812, embarked on his literary journey at a young age. After leaving school at 15 due to his family’s financial struggles, he worked as a law clerk and then a shorthand reporter in the courts. This exposure to the legal system and the diverse characters he encountered would later inspire many of his novels. In 1833, he began his career as a journalist, contributing sketches and articles to various periodicals under the pseudonym “Boz.” His first significant success came with “The Pickwick Papers,” a serial novel published in 1836-37, which launched him into fame and established his unique storytelling style.

Other Ventures

Besides his literary works, Dickens was also involved in various other ventures. He edited and published several journals, including “Household Words” and “All the Year Round.” Additionally, he was a prominent public reader, delivering dramatic readings of his works to large audiences. Dickens also acted as a freelance journalist, contributing to numerous newspapers and magazines.
